The Casements was the winter home of oil magnate John D. Rockefeller, who sought the warm climate for his health. Today, this historic estate operates as a museum and cultural center, offering guided tours of the preserved rooms, including Rockefeller's personal study and the grand ballroom. Visitors can stroll through the beautifully maintained gardens, which feature tropical plants and a reflecting pool. The site also hosts art exhibits, concerts, and community events, making it a vibrant cultural hub in Daytona Beach.
